Can someone please confirm the correct hose size for the float overflow barbs. BS38. Seems whatever I get is too large or two small. Many thanks for this relatively simple question. Rainy here blah. T.
I do not have the size info, but most likely it is metric. For example 3.0 mm. Hose is commonly sold in imperial sizes, and 1/8" would be a little bit bigger, approx. 3.2 mm. That may be the cause of your problems.
